CJ Logistics Expands 'Customized Health Checkups' for Delivery Workers
[Asia Economy Reporter Hyunseok Yoo] CJ Logistics is adding various screening options to its customized health checkup program to help delivery workers, who are self-employed, manage their health more proactively.
On the 19th, CJ Logistics announced that it will expand its ‘2030 Customized Health Checkup Program’ by additionally supporting a ‘Health Checkup Center Visit Service’ alongside the existing ‘On-site Health Checkup Service’ for self-employed delivery workers.
About 20,000 delivery workers can receive a comprehensive health checkup free of charge every year through the customized health checkup program, which includes more than 60 different tests such as diabetes, kidney disease, liver fibrosis, and liver function tests. For convenience, professional medical institutions visit delivery sub-terminals scattered nationwide to conduct the checkups, which has been well received by delivery workers.
After the health checkup, a systematic follow-up management system based on the test results is also operated. If classified as a high-risk group based on the results, the ‘In-depth Health Checkup Service’ is provided, allowing workers to receive detailed examinations at hospitals without bearing the cost of the tests.
Additionally, based on health checkup records, a free health consultation service is offered, providing professional medical staff consultations ranging from basic health counseling to musculoskeletal disorder prevention and cerebrovascular disease counseling.
Starting this year, the existing health checkup program will also include the ‘Health Checkup Center Visit Service.’ If delivery workers are unable to receive the ‘On-site Health Checkup’ due to personal circumstances, they can now visit a health checkup center directly according to their preferred schedule.
In particular, a leave cost support system has been established to help delivery workers receive checkups more conveniently by compensating for leave expenses when they take time off from delivery work to visit the health checkup center.

A CJ Logistics official said, “We provide various welfare benefits to self-employed delivery workers, including support for children’s tuition, marriage, childbirth-related congratulatory and condolence events, health checkups, and health consultation services. We will continue to expand industry-leading treatment and welfare benefits and strive to provide the best delivery service.”
